    Our Medical Records Technicians are given company laptops and portable scanners to travel to various medical facilities and hospitals to scan patient medical records.

    Duties and Responsibilities

    Maintain a record system for patient information and gathering documents

    Ensure medical records are organized, accurate, and complete

    Create digital copies of paperwork and store records electronically

    File paperwork/reports quickly and accurately

    Ensure HIPAA standards

    Use electronic system to properly collect, organize and manage data

    Follow all confidentiality guidelines, rules, and procedures

    Interact with medical staff, healthcare providers, and other medical personnel
